Chronic nicotine exposure reduces klotho expression and triggers different renal and hemodynamic responses in klotho-haploinsufficient mice.
American journal of physiology. Renal physiology - 1 May 2018
Coelho Fernanda Oliveira, Jorge Lecticia Barbosa, de Bragança Viciana Ana Carolina, Sanches Talita R, Dos Santos Fernando, Helou Claudia M B, Irigoyen Maria Claudia, Kuro-O Makoto, Andrade Lucia
Abstract excerpt
The klotho gene, which encodes a single-pass transmembrane protein and a secreted protein, is expressed predominantly by the distal renal tubules and is related to calcium phosphorus metabolism, ion channel regulation, intracellular signaling pathways, and longevity. Klotho deficiency aggravates acute kidney injury and renal fibrosis. Exposure to nicotine also worsens kidney injury. Here, we investigated renal...
